Netflix
With the right mobile apps, you can get ad-free Netflix. If you’ve been wanting to catch up on shows like Bridgerton or The Night Agent, or rewatch hits like Stranger Things, Squid Game and Wednesday, this is for you. To grab this freebie, you will need to have two or more lines with the following plans: Go5G, Go5G Next, Go5G Plus, Magenta, Magenta Max, or any Experience More or Experience Beyond plan. Included in the agreement are military, 55 and First Response programs, as well.
If you’re a Netflix subscriber, you’ll be able to take part in this perk with one of the T-Mobile plans mentioned above. Go to Additions section of your account page to sign up for your Netflix offer.
You can also choose to upgrade and stream ad-free Netflix Premium for $18 per month ($7 off the regular price) on your T-Mobile bill.
Hulu
When you sign up for any Experience Beyond or Go5G Next mobile plan, T-Mobile will include ad-supported Hulu for free. One Hulu offer is available per T-Mobile account, and this deal only applies to new and returning T-Mobile customers. To use, just follow the instructions written here, and you’ll be good to go.
Please note that there is no discount if you wish to switch to a different Hulu plan. And if you already pay for Hulu but want to use T-Mobile’s freebie instead, you’ll need to cancel your current subscription first.
Paramount Plus
Those of you with an All-In home Internet plan can access the ad-supported Paramount Plus Essential Plan at no additional cost. You can watch a series of TV shows (incl Song by Taylor SheridanLandman) and movies from networks like CBS, Nickelodeon and Comedy Central, as well as live shows and a small set of live channels. You can activate a live streaming subscription directly with your T-Mobile bill.
SiriusXM
Do you have a T-Mobile wireless plan, such as the Experience Beyond, Experience More, or Go5G plans? However, you can get the SiriusXM All Access plan (app-only) for free for six months. To grab this deal, just add it to your account. After the six-month promo ends, customers will be charged the full price for the service, currently $10 per month.
New and returning SiriusXM subscribers who would like to use this can, as long as you have not had an active subscription to the satellite radio service in the past 12 months.
Pandora
Speaking of streaming music, four months of Pandora Premium are included for free if you’re a T-Mobile postpaid mobile customer. You can add the Pandora Premium On Us benefit to your account through the T-Mobile website or app to take advantage of this opportunity. After the four months are up, your bill will reflect the regular Pandora Premium price, currently $11 per month.
Apple TV will no longer be free
Starting in 2021, T-Mobile has offered its subscribers limited access to Apple TV. That deal ended on Jan. 1, 2026. Customers with paid mobile and voice plans have seen the free benefit replaced by a $3 monthly fee for the broadcaster. T-Mobile startups can also sign up for the deal.
This change reflects the recent price increase of Apple TV from $10 to $13 per month. Anyone with 55+ and Senior plans, as well as phone plans for members of the military, first responders, and people with hearing or vision impairments, will get this deal for $3 for six months. Although not free, this new price is still a significant discount for the broadcaster.
